Obtendo 503 ao tentar executar ASP clássico no Win7 e IIS7.5

3

Estou sendo solicitado a ressuscitar um aplicativo ASP clássico para uso temporário. Maravilhoso. Bem, o pagamento é o mesmo, então agora estou tentando fazer com que a coisa seja executada no meu host local para que eu possa testá-lo e assim por diante. Eu copiei todos os arquivos para c: \ inetpub \ wwwroot \ ClassicASPapp. Usando o IIS 7.5 eu definir esta pasta como um aplicativo recebo um 503. O mesmo resultado se eu fizer um diretório virtual.

HTTP Error 503. The service is unavailable.

Observe que há um arquivo no wwwroot chamado "iisstart.htm". Se eu clicar duas vezes no arquivo no Windows Explorer, o navegador exibirá o HTML renderizado corretamente. Se eu tentar navegar para o arquivo usando:

http://localhost/iisstart.htm

Eu também recebo o 503.

O que está acontecendo? Existe algum cenário global que eu preciso mudar? Note que esta é uma nova estação de trabalho do Windows 7.

Eu verifiquei e o ASP clássico está definitivamente instalado. O site está associado a um pool de aplicativos com o Classic ASP habilitado e os aplicativos de 32 bits também estão habilitados.

Log de eventos:

Log Name:      System
Source:        Microsoft-Windows-WAS
Date:          8/8/2014 2:42:49 PM
Event ID:      5002
Task Category: None
Level:         Error
Keywords:      Classic
User:          N/A
Computer:      DESD71906.EClient.wa.lcl
Description:
Application pool 'DefaultAppPool' is being automatically disabled due to a series of failures in the process(es) serving that application pool.
Event Xml:
<Event xmlns="http://schemas.microsoft.com/win/2004/08/events/event">
  <System>
    <Provider Name="Microsoft-Windows-WAS" Guid="{524B5D04-133C-4A62-8362-64E8EDB9CE40}" EventSourceName="WAS" />
    <EventID Qualifiers="49152">5002</EventID>
    <Version>0</Version>
    <Level>2</Level>
    <Task>0</Task>
    <Opcode>0</Opcode>
    <Keywords>0x80000000000000</Keywords>
    <TimeCreated SystemTime="2014-08-08T21:42:49.000000000Z" />
    <EventRecordID>40664</EventRecordID>
    <Correlation />
    <Execution ProcessID="0" ThreadID="0" />
    <Channel>System</Channel>
    <Computer>DESD71906.EClient.wa.lcl</Computer>
    <Security />
  </System>
  <EventData>
    <Data Name="AppPoolID">DefaultAppPool</Data>
    <Binary>
    </Binary>
  </EventData>
</Event>

É verdade que o pool de aplicativos é interrompido.

Conexão de teste / Detalhes da autorização:

The server is configured to use pass-through authentication with a built-in account to access the specified physical path. However, IIS Manager cannot verify whether the built-in account has access. Make sure that the application pool identity has Read access to the physical path. If this server is joined to a domain, and the application pool identity is NetworkService or LocalSystem, verify that \$ has Read access to the physical path. Then test these settings again.

    
por Cyberherbalist 07.08.2014 / 19:51

0 respostas